Cartoon fans start Spongebob church

Click to enlarge photo
Fans of the hit nautical cartoon Spongebob Squarepants have set up their own church.

The cartoon features a kitchen sponge who lives with his friends in a place called Bikini Bottom in the Pacific Ocean.

The cartoon is designed for children under four but has already won star fans like Justin Timberlake, Britney Spears, Kelly Osbourne and Mike Myers.

Now it has its own officially registered church, in the US, which teaches its own spiritual way of life.

Members of the Church of Spongebob meet up for services everywhere from New York and California to Texas.

The 700-strong membership have taken an official conversion sacrament to pledge their loyalty to the church.

There is also an intense study course for the church based on the Spongebob scriptures.

The church's manifesto says it promotes "simple things like having fun and using your imagination".

Recently 5000 people applied to watch the cartoon, which is broadcast on Nickelodeon and being turned into a movie, to work out why it is so funny.

Nickelodeon spokesperson Reeta Bhatiani said: "Spongebob's appeal is extraordinary."
